Upon examining a micrograph, you notice a region of red pulp and white pulp. which lymphoid organ is the micrograph?

A micrograph is a picture taken with a use of a microscope.

The red pulp and white pulp are found in the Spleen. The spleen is a major lympoid organ. It is around 5 inches long and is attached to the stomach. 

The red pulp acts as the filtration system of the blood. The white pulp mounts the responses of the adaptive T and B cells.
